📱 How to Send Receipts to Customers on WhatsApp in Nigeria
WhatsApp has become the most popular business tool in Nigeria. From POS operators and fashion vendors to freelancers and small shops, most transactions today start and end on WhatsApp.
However, while many vendors use it to communicate and receive payments, few use it to send digital receipts — a simple but powerful way to look professional, confirm payments, and keep accurate records.
With the right free tool, you can now generate ₦ Naira receipts and send them to your customers directly on WhatsApp in seconds.
đź’ˇ Why You Should Send Receipts on WhatsApp
Instant confirmation
Customers receive proof of payment immediately after a transaction.
Improved trust
A branded, professional receipt helps customers take your business seriously.
Easy records
Receipts stay saved in your WhatsApp chats and can be searched later.
Zero cost
Free tools make it possible to generate and send receipts without paying for software or apps.
Digital receipts are especially useful for Nigerian SMEs, mobile vendors, and freelancers who work primarily through WhatsApp and bank transfers.
⚙️ Step-by-Step: How to Send a Receipt on WhatsApp
Step 1: Create the Receipt
Open a trusted digital receipt platform designed for Nigerian businesses such as Nairatrack.com. It works instantly in your browser without installation or sign-up.
Step 2: Fill in Details
Enter your business name, customer name or phone number, item or service description, amount in ₦, and date. The total will be calculated automatically.
Step 3: Add Branding
Include your business logo, VAT (7.5%), or a note such as “Thank you for your purchase.”
Step 4: Generate and Preview
Click “Generate Receipt.” Review the information carefully before sharing.
Step 5: Send on WhatsApp
Tap the WhatsApp icon on the receipt page. It opens directly in WhatsApp where you can select your customer and send. The receipt appears instantly as an image or downloadable link.
Step 6: Save or Download
Keep a copy as a PDF for offline access. Many platforms automatically save your receipts in the cloud for future tracking.
đź’¬ Professional Tips for Sending Receipts
- Always confirm payment before issuing a receipt.
- Include your full business name, logo, and contact information.
- Keep messages clean and professional without emojis or long chats.
- Use polite follow-ups like “Thank you for your payment.”
- Store backup copies in your email or cloud folder for reference.
Are WhatsApp Receipts Accepted in Nigeria?
Yes. The Federal Inland Revenue Service (FIRS) accepts digital receipts as valid transaction records.
As long as the receipt includes the business name, customer name, amount, date, and receipt number, it is considered valid for documentation, accounting, and tax purposes.
